Facebook pixel
>Blog>Programação
Programação

Como Criar Algoritmos No Portugol: Guia Completo Para Iniciantes

Aprenda como fazer algoritmo no Portugol com este guia completo para iniciantes.




Como criar algoritmos no Portugol: Guia completo para iniciantes

Como criar algoritmos no Portugol: Guia completo para iniciantes

Criar algoritmos pode parecer uma tarefa complexa no início, mas com o Portugol, uma linguagem de programação estruturada em português, você pode dar os primeiros passos de forma mais acessível. Neste guia completo para iniciantes, vamos explorar os fundamentos e as melhores práticas para criar algoritmos no Portugol.

Programação Back-End Desenvolva sistemas, APIs e aplicações web escaláveis e flexíveis com JavaScript e Node.js, aprendendo como utilizar bancos de dados SQL e NoSQL, implementar testes unitários, além de adotar boas práticas e design patterns em código. Começar Agora
Nossa metodologia de ensino tem eficiência comprovada
Curso da Awari em Programação Back-End
15h de carga horária 2 semanas de duração Certificado de conclusão Mentorias individuais

Primeiros passos para criar algoritmos no Portugol

Antes de mergulharmos nos detalhes, é importante entender os conceitos básicos para criar algoritmos no Portugol. Aqui estão alguns passos iniciais que você pode seguir:

  1. Instale o Portugol: Para começar, você precisa baixar e instalar o Portugol Studio em seu computador. Essa ferramenta gratuita oferece um ambiente de desenvolvimento integrado (IDE) que permite escrever e testar seus algoritmos de maneira fácil.
  2. Conheça a sintaxe básica: Assim como qualquer linguagem de programação, o Portugol possui uma sintaxe específica. É importante aprender os comandos básicos, como a estrutura de controle condicional (se…então…senão) e a estrutura de repetição (enquanto…faça). Familiarize-se com esses conceitos para poder desenvolver algoritmos eficientes.
  3. Entenda a lógica de programação: Antes de começar a escrever algoritmos, é essencial compreender os princípios da lógica de programação. Isso inclui entender os operadores lógicos (AND, OR, NOT), a manipulação de variáveis e a resolução de problemas por meio de algoritmos. Procure materiais de estudo ou cursos online para aprimorar seus conhecimentos nessa área.

Principais conceitos para criar algoritmos no Portugol

Agora que você já conhece os primeiros passos, vamos explorar alguns conceitos-chave para criar algoritmos no Portugol:

  1. Variáveis e tipos de dados: No Portugol, você precisa declarar as variáveis antes de usá-las. Existem diferentes tipos de dados, como números inteiros, números reais, caracteres e boleanos. Compreender como trabalhar com esses tipos de dados é crucial para o desenvolvimento correto de algoritmos.
  2. Estruturas de controle: O Portugol oferece uma variedade de estruturas de controle que permitem controlar o fluxo de execução do algoritmo. Além do condicional “se…então…senão” e do loop “enquanto…faça”, existem também estruturas como o “para” e o “escolha”. Dominar essas estruturas é fundamental para criar algoritmos mais avançados.
  3. Funções e procedimentos: No Portugol, você pode criar suas próprias funções e procedimentos para organizar melhor o código e reutilizá-lo em diferentes partes do algoritmo. Isso ajuda a tornar o código mais modular e facilita a manutenção e a legibilidade.

Dicas e boas práticas para criar algoritmos no Portugol

Aqui estão algumas dicas e boas práticas que podem ajudá-lo a criar algoritmos mais eficientes e legíveis no Portugol:

Programação Back-End Desenvolva sistemas, APIs e aplicações web escaláveis e flexíveis com JavaScript e Node.js, aprendendo como utilizar bancos de dados SQL e NoSQL, implementar testes unitários, além de adotar boas práticas e design patterns em código. Começar Agora
Nossa metodologia de ensino tem eficiência comprovada
Curso da Awari em Programação Back-End
15h de carga horária 2 semanas de duração Certificado de conclusão Mentorias individuais
  • Planeje antes de começar: Antes de escrever o código, faça um planejamento detalhado do algoritmo. Identifique os passos necessários e a ordem em que devem ser executados. Isso ajuda a evitar erros e a otimizar o desempenho do algoritmo.
  • Utilize nomes descritivos: Ao declarar variáveis e funções, escolha nomes descritivos que indiquem claramente o propósito daquela parte do código. Isso facilita a compreensão do algoritmo por outros programadores e até mesmo por você mesmo em futuras revisões.
  • Comente o código: Adicione comentários explicativos ao longo do seu algoritmo. Isso ajuda a documentar o código e esclarece o objetivo de cada trecho. Os comentários também facilitam a manutenção e a colaboração com outros desenvolvedores.
  • Teste e depure o algoritmo: Antes de considerar seu algoritmo pronto, teste-o exaustivamente e depure eventuais erros. Utilize casos de teste variados para garantir que o algoritmo funcione corretamente em diferentes situações. A depuração é uma etapa importante para identificar e corrigir falhas no código.
  • Mantenha-se atualizado: A área da programação está em constante evolução. Mantenha-se atualizado com as novidades do Portugol e da programação em geral. Acompanhe fóruns, blogs e cursos online para expandir seus conhecimentos e aprimorar suas habilidades como desenvolvedor.

Conclusão

Criar algoritmos no Portugol pode ser uma jornada empolgante para iniciantes na programação. Com os conceitos básicos, as práticas recomendadas e a prática constante, você estará preparado para enfrentar desafios maiores e desenvolver algoritmos mais complexos. Lembre-se de que a prática é fundamental para aprimorar suas habilidades como programador. Não tenha medo de errar e esteja sempre disposto a aprender. Como Criar Algoritmos No Portugol: Guia Completo Para Iniciantes é um ótimo ponto de partida para sua jornada na programação.


Programação Back-End Desenvolva sistemas, APIs e aplicações web escaláveis e flexíveis com JavaScript e Node.js, aprendendo como utilizar bancos de dados SQL e NoSQL, implementar testes unitários, além de adotar boas práticas e design patterns em código. Começar Agora
Nossa metodologia de ensino tem eficiência comprovada
Curso da Awari em Programação Back-End
15h de carga horária 2 semanas de duração Certificado de conclusão Mentorias individuais

Curso Completo de
Programação Back-End

Desenvolva sistemas, APIs e aplicações web escaláveis e flexíveis com JavaScript e Node.js, aprendendo como utilizar bancos de dados SQL e NoSQL, implementar testes unitários, além de adotar boas práticas e design patterns em código.

Ao clicar no botão ”Começar Agora”, você concorda com os nossos Termos de Uso e Política de Privacidade.

CONHEÇA A AWARI

Compartilhe seus objetivos de carreira com a Awari

Nós queremos construir uma comunidade onde membros tenham objetivos compartilhados, e levamos essas respostas em consideração na hora de avaliar sua candidatura.

Sobre o autor

Dê um salto em sua carreira com nosso curso de Programação Back-End

Desenvolva sistemas, APIs e aplicações web escaláveis e flexíveis com JavaScript e Node.js, aprendendo como utilizar bancos de dados SQL e NoSQL, implementar testes unitários, além de adotar boas práticas e design patterns em código.